Rotary Kiln

• Formation of C3A and C4AF begins, decomposition of


CaCO3 completed, free lime reaches maximum

• Formation of C2S reaches maximum,


C3A and C4AF formation completed

• Formation of liquid phase

l Formation of C3S, gradual decrease 9


o f f r e e l i m e c o n t e n t .
Clinker

MINERALOGICAL COMPOSITION OF CLINKER

• Tricalcium silicate (C3S) or


alite, dicalcium silicate
(C2S) or belite, tricalcium
aluminate (C3A) and
tetracalcium aluminoferrite
(C4AF) are the main clinker
constituents

Cement Chemical Composition
Weight
Cement Compound Chemical Formula
Percentage

Tricalcium silicate 50 % Ca3SiO5 or 3CaO.SiO2

Dicalcium silicate 25 % Ca2SiO4 or 2CaO.SiO2

Tricalcium aluminate 10 % Ca3Al2O6 or 3CaO .Al2O3

Tetracalcium Ca4Al2Fe2O10 or
10 %
aluminoferrite 4CaO.Al2O3.Fe2O3

Gypsum 5% CaSO4.2H2O
